My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Krissie is an extremely gentle, affectionate, well mannered yound dog who will make someone a great pet. She has the sweetest face and disposition as she is very laid back and will just melt your heart. Unfortunately Krissie was apparently hit by a car before coming to ALOE and won't put any weight on her rear left leg although you can hardly tell as hard as she runs and plays. She has been examined and x rayed by a vet who says she has a broken knee. The vet orthopedic surgeon who examined her x rays says to give her 4 to 6 weeks and it might heal itself. She appears to be putting more and more weight on the leg. If surgery is needed ALOE will raise funds to pay for it. Krissie is up to date on all shots, spayed, microchipped and is available for adoption or foster by someone willing to take a dog in site of her leg injury and possible surgery in the near future. Krissie is a really great dog who will be a wonderful, loving pet for someone. She was featured on channel 4's Low Country Live on July 17.
